Luther looks to move into title contention

August 21, 2009 By admin

The Luther football team hopes to move into title contention in the Iowa Conference race this season. The Norsemen finished 5-5 a year ago in Mike Durnin’s first season as head coach. He likes their chances to climb in the standings. He says they have some juniors and sophomores that got a lot of playing time last year that return to go with the seniors.

Durnin says pre-season camp is a critical time of the season as he says you need to get schemes retaught to be sure they are ready to take on the game of football mentally. Then physically they have to be ready to handle the contact. Durnin hopes the defense is as successful as it was in 2008. The Norse ranked second in the Iowa Conference in defense and they gave up only 14.5 points per contest.

He says they need turnovers and to stop the explosive plays to keep the other team out of the endzone. Quarterback Chris Reynolds returns after earning the starting job as a freshman. Luther’s offense is looking to improve after ranking eighth in the league in ’08.

Luther opens the season at St. Olaf on September fifth.
